New statistics reveal the vast majority of assaults at public swimming pools in the UK take place in unisex change rooms. According to data obtained by The Sunday Times, almost 90% of reported sexual assaults, harassment and voyeurism in swimming pool and sports-centre change rooms happened in unisex facilities. Of the 134 incidents reported in the UK last year, 120 of those were carried out in gender-neutral change rooms, while just 14 took place in single-sex changing areas. Nasreen Akhter and her husband Mohammed Shabaz Khan were married in London almost 20 years ago according to an Islamic ceremony called nikah, a union not recognised under British matrimonial law. When Mrs Akhtar filed for divorce, Mr Khan attempted to block the application in a UK court on the basis that they were never legally married. However, he High Court ruled on Wednesday that the Pakistani couple’s sharia marriage falls under British matrimonial law and should be recognised because the couple, lived as man and wife since 1998.
